Providing the warm, rich tone that Aguilar gear is famous for, the Chorusaurus® uses analog, bucket-brigade technology for lush, organic chorusing.

Chorus is one of the most popular types of effects used by bass players, and the Aguilar Chorusaurus® is one of the best: it gives bassists unparalleled control of their tone with an intuitive, four-knob layout. BLEND controls the ratio of dry and wet signals.

The RATE, INTENSITY and WIDTH controls provide maximum tonal sculpting. Now you can dial in subtle swirling textures, extreme chorusing or anything in between!

Specs:

  • Analog Bucket-Brigade technology
  • Gig-saver bypass (signal passes even if your battery dies)
  • Inputs: One 1/4" jack
  • Outputs: One 1/4" jack – For Mono output use a standard ¼” cable to your amplifier. For stereo operation to two amplifiers use a ¼” Y cable with one ¼” TRS to two ¼” TS jacks.
  • Power: Nine-volt battery or optional universal power supply
  • Controls: Engage switch
  • Warranty: Three year limited
  • Optional: 9 volt power supply
